Mrs. Mary E. Crooks, 65, wife of Ira Allen Crooks died in the family home on North Tipton street last evening. Mrs. Crooks was a native of Oregon and was born on April 27, 1867. She had resided in California for 63 years and had been a resident of Visalia for 10 years. She was a member of the Full Gospel church of this city.
Survivors include, besides the widower, three sons, Sanford Gist of Bakersfield, John H.[sic] Gist of Napa and Calvin Gist of Morgan Hill; four daughters, Lillie Gist of Napa, May Wallace, Doris Gerber and Flora Gist, all of Los Angeles; and two sisters, Mrs. Myrtle K. Hanigan of Bakersfield and Mrs. Julian Gist, also of Bakersfield.
Funeral services will be conducted at 2 o’clock tomorrow afternoon. A. E. Brooks & Son are in charge of arrangements. Rev. Gordon Shannon, pastor of the Full Gospel church of Visalia, is to officiate, and interment will be in the Visalia City cemetery.
Visalia Times-Delta, Visalia, California, Friday, 20 Jan 1933, Page 2.
